Thank You, Feedback Contributors

Regular visitors to REACH’s website will be all too familiar with contributors such as “Raymond Lo Wan Mou”, “Piaofu”, “Lai CF” and “Om Nath Panday”. While many of us may have read their postings or even exchanged thoughts and suggestions with them on REACH’s blogs and discussion forums, most of us may not have had the chance to put a face to these names, and get to know the person behind the contributions and postings.

However, on 7th January 2009, this became possible, at the Singapore Flyer no less. These active and loyal feedback contributors were specially invited to the REACH Contributors’ Appreciation Lunch hosted by Minister for Community Development, Youth and Sports Dr Vivian Balakrishnan and REACH Chairman Dr Amy Khor. The Appreciation Lunch was well-received, with over 100 REACH Panel Members, Policy Study Workgroups (PSW) members, Junior REACH Ambassadors (JRAs), and of course, regular feedback contributors in attendance.

At the appreciation lunch, Dr Amy Khor thanked feedback contributors for their invaluable contribution and feedback. Minister Dr Vivian Balakrishnan also gave a short speech, during which he stressed three “I”s in the citizen engagement process:

  1. Information - Sufficient, credible and unbiased information, to deepen citizens' understanding of the issues at hand;
  2. Interaction – Making use of REACH platforms to respond quickly and enhance interaction, especially on major or more important issues.
  3. Involvement - Increasing the number of Singaporeans who feel that they have participated in nation-building, problem-solving and creating the future.

Also at the Appreciation Lunch, we launched two new initiatives - in the form of the Feedback Facilitator (F2) programme to facilitate greater engagement of heartlanders, and a new Youth Vibes webpage.

The five new F2 appointees beamed with pride as they received their letters of appointment from Dr Amy Khor. Our new Feedback Facilitators are:

Following the appointment of the F2, two of our JRAs – Kwan Jin Yao and Leonard Royce Yong from Hwa Chong Institution and Victoria Junior College respectively, presented the new “Youth Vibes” webpage to guests. “Youth Vibes” (www.reach.gov.sg/youthvibes) is an interactive webpage created as part of REACH’s commitment to engage youths in the feedback process.

We hope that through this new “for youth, by youth” webpage, youths will find that they have a cool avenue to express their opinions on issues that matter to them, and that the level of awareness of national issues among youths will be raised.
